Labor’s Disenchantment in Ohio Places Even Democratic Veterans at Threat

TOLEDO, Ohio — Consultant Marcy Kaptur, the blue-collar daughter of this blue-collar metropolis, is on the cusp of a milestone: If elected in November to her twenty first time period, she’s going to develop into the longest-serving feminine member of Congress, breaking Barbara Mikulski’s mixed Home and Senate report.

However for Ms. Kaptur, 75, a famously pro-union, old-school appropriator, the political floor has washed away beneath her toes. A brand new Republican-drawn district has robbed her of dependable Democratic votes on the outskirts of Cleveland. The nationwide Democratic Social gathering has saddled her with an agenda of phasing out inside combustion engines and the fossil fuels that energy them that sits poorly within the area that put the primary Jeeps into mass manufacturing.

And Donald J. Trump rattled the underpinnings of Democratic enchantment to labor, along with his commerce protectionism, thundering denunciations of China and professed perception in job creation in any respect price.

As Republican voters go to the polls on Tuesday to pick out Ms. Kaptur’s opponent for the autumn election, a few of her oldest, firmest allies within the union world are having their doubts — about Ms. Kaptur’s future, and extra broadly, the way forward for the Democratic Social gathering within the industrial heartland.

“Hear, Marcy is a pal,” stated Shaun Enright, government secretary and enterprise supervisor of the 17,000-strong Northwest Ohio Constructing Trades Council. “However I’ve to go to membership, regardless of the election cycle is, and say, ‘That is an important election of your life. It’s a must to vote.’ And I’m uninterested in doing it. Members are uninterested in listening to it.”

Ms. Kaptur’s longevity was purported to underscore a truism that union households knew their associates and wouldn’t abandon them. Democratic senators like Sherrod Brown of Ohio, Bob Casey of Pennsylvania and Joe Manchin III of West Virginia have banked on it. Consultant Tim Ryan is testing it along with his run for an Ohio Senate seat that to date has revolved round blue-collar appeals.

Mr. Trump would have received Ms. Kaptur’s newly drawn district by three proportion factors, however within the components that overlapped the previous map, Ms. Kaptur outperformed Joseph R. Biden Jr. by six proportion factors, giving some hope — at the very least numerically — that her identify recognition, lengthy report and normal recognition might nonetheless ship that forty first yr in Congress.

“My service has now afforded me the flexibility to make a distinction,” she stated in an interview, boasting of her seat on the highly effective Appropriations Committee and her chairmanship of the subcommittee that doles out vitality and water funding.

However her battle to succeed in that historic mark attests to what Republicans and a few union leaders right here have been saying for the reason that rise of Trumpism: Labor politics have modified eternally. There are fewer union voters, and those who stay are much less Democratic, stated Jeff Broxmeyer, a political scientist on the College of Toledo. Since 1990, the proportion of Ohio employees represented by unions has slipped from 23.2 p.c to 13 p.c.

“The organizational capability of the Democratic Social gathering in northwest Ohio is the organizational capability of organized labor, and arranged labor is way diminished,” he stated. “Now we’re on the endgame.”

The state legislature lopped off the tail of Ms. Kaptur’s oddly drawn district alongside Lake Erie — nicknamed the Snake on the Lake — then prolonged it west by rural Ohio to the Indiana border. That, Professor Broxmeyer stated, signaled that Republicans “are coming for the final Democrat.”

It was not that way back, 2012, that Barack Obama received Ohio’s union households, 61 p.c to Mitt Romney’s 37 p.c. However Mr. Trump took 54 p.c of those self same voters in 2016, then 55 p.c in 2020. Whereas on the coasts, prognosticators fret over the previous president’s continued maintain on the Republican Social gathering, in northwest Ohio, the social gathering’s embrace of Trump-era protectionism, immigration exclusion and anti-environmentalism is cheered heartily.

“A whole lot of these union employees, they’re not proud of their unions proper now,” stated Craig Riedel, a state consultant working within the Republican major to problem Ms. Kaptur. “They notice that a variety of these union bosses, they’re a part of the Democratic machine, and oftentimes, they’re taking a look at a political outlook of their unions that’s in disalignment with their very own.”

Union leaders agree that it’s turning into rather more tough to paper over disagreements between native Democrats and their nationwide social gathering when Trump-aligned Republican candidates are utilizing the identical anti-China, anti-trade rhetoric that Ohio Democrats use. Erika White, president of the Communications Employees of America native in northwest Ohio, stated Mr. Trump had given voice to the anger of white employees, even when he didn’t ship on his guarantees.

Ms. White, who’s Black, stated she spends a lot of her time listening to the frustrations of the white males who make up about half of her union.

“I personally can’t stand the man, however you consider his persona,” she stated of Mr. Trump. “The place individuals are, I don’t know in the event that they’re afraid of accountability or the place we’re headed, however as an alternative of non-public duty, they are saying, ‘I’d somewhat blame you for all my issues, after which not solely am I going accountable you, I’m going to be imply and aggressive with it.’”

Ms. Kaptur sees it too, and sees Mr. Trump’s enchantment, regardless of his failure to ship tangible advantages.

“Our social gathering, for probably the most half, could be very coastally oriented,” she stated, including, “Our a part of the nation simply doesn’t have a lot voice, and so partly what he displays is that vacuum of individuals feeling not noted, and I can perceive that.”

In Toledo, a burning problem is a pure gasoline and crude oil pipeline known as Line 5 that runs on the ground of the Nice Lakes from Canada to Ohio, supplying a refinery right here that employs 1,200 union employees.

The Democratic administration of Gov. Gretchen Whitmer in Michigan has labeled it a “ticking time bomb” that must be shut down, and allies within the environmental motion say employees must face actuality: Because the auto trade shifts to electrical automobiles, oil pipelines and refineries will not be wanted.

However what nationwide Democrats see as a planetary crucial, union leaders like Mr. Enright see as an instantaneous mortal risk, and so they absolutely anticipate the politicians they again to battle for his or her jobs. Meaning retaining Line 5 open and the shift to electrical automobiles within the lowest potential gear.

“Democrats say they’re those engaged on behalf of individuals’s pocketbooks, however how do I inform my members that’s the man working to assist your pocketbook when that’s the man who’s shutting down the pipeline to your refinery?” Mr. Enright requested.

A problem like Line 5 is simple for the Republicans within the race. It unites unions and enterprise, with out alienating another constituency.

“I imply, it’s 1,200 direct jobs, and hundreds of oblique jobs, which embody union employees in good paying jobs, and Marcy Kaptur has been silent,” stated State Senator Theresa Gavarone, a number one Republican within the race, as she shook arms at Archbold Excessive Faculty within the rural west of the newly drawn district.

Ms. Gavarone has used the Line 5 problem to make allies within the constructing trades unions, and used these allies to separate herself from Mr. Riedel, who’s brazenly anti-union.

Ms. Kaptur responded defensively, however she additionally confirmed the crosscurrents she faces. As chairwoman of the Vitality and Water Appropriations subcommittee, she stated she had executed what she might to guard and transfer to strengthen the pipeline. However she additionally leads the Nice Lakes Caucus within the Home, and defending the biggest physique of freshwater on Earth, she stated, additionally must be a precedence.

That Mr. Trump by no means appeared bothered by such conflicts frustrates her, and she or he doesn’t appear clear on learn how to overcome his enchantment in a area drained by globalization and left behind, first by free commerce, then by the altering priorities of environmental safety and an data and expertise financial system.

However she is completely clear about her constituents’ viewpoint.

“He was in a position to prick the despair that outcomes from financial alternative being jerked out from beneath you want a rug, and he was in a position to do it although he didn’t do something for them,” Ms. Kaptur fumed. “These are individuals who’ve labored onerous all their lives, after which an earthquake occurred. That’s not their fault, and largely Washington by no means noticed it.”
